Transaction 34daccbbf16d43ae6a829d7804dfa83bfd5f10641ca7e7dbed36b0a09f146692

17 Input
2 Outputs
  • 34daccbbf16d43ae6a829d7804dfa83bfd5f10641ca7e7dbed36b0a09f146692:0
  • value  25843404
    address  1NrzV5zZ7DdWtt9iugWzm9GFjahVkyeaR4
  • 34daccbbf16d43ae6a829d7804dfa83bfd5f10641ca7e7dbed36b0a09f146692:1
  • value  994514
    address  bc1q75enrukt5kujhk4pna50csrtmdtqhm2c2tpfka